JOB DESCRIPTION Make your mark for patients We are looking for an Immunology Learning Lead who is strategic, collaborative, and future-focused to join us in our Talent Acquisition & Learning team. This is a hybrid position based in our Atlanta, GA Offices. About the Role As the Immunology Learning Lead, you will own the endtoend US learning strategy for our immunology portfolio across launch and lifecycle phases. You will translate global asset strategies into USrelevant, capabilitybased learning roadmaps, anticipating evolving business needs and enabling launch readiness, execution excellence, and sustained performance. You will bring a strong bias for action, proactively identifying capability gaps and translating them into impactful learning solutions-often before business partners formally articulate the need. In this role, you will lead a team of learning professionals and serve as a key integrator across Medical, Commercial, Access, and global learning partners. Who You'll Work With You will work closely with US Medical, Commercial, Access, and Patient Evidence & Impact learning teams, as well as global asset learning partners. You will regularly engage with senior US brand, medical, and learning leaders, influencing outcomes in a highly matrixed environment-often without direct authority.
